Cheap Monday jumps in with Ripped Jeans

It seems that suddenly everyone is jumping in on the ripped jeans trend bandwagon; from the crazy hot Natasha Poly in Vogue Paris to scientology enthusiast Katie Holmes. And that's a good thing, because, frankly, it's a much better look than the boyfriend jeans trend.

So with the trend's popularity growing it comes as no surprise to see brands including it in their 2009 Spring/Summer collections. As we've seen ripped jeans from Balmain, so too do we now see it from Cheap Mondays amongst their Spring/Summer 2009 offering.

Cheap Monday Ripped Jeans

With their high waist and light wash, these ripped Cheap Monday jeans could qualify as a perfect pair. However, the oversized rip on the left thigh is bigger than we might otherwie expect. Still, keep your legs tanned and you'll have our thumbs up.
